I watched this program -- it was disgusting. People are traveling from all over the world to be "operated on" by this charlatan -- who jams forceps up people's noses to "cure" them -- and ABC did a fantastic job of making it look like he just might be performing "miracles." For instance, the one doctor they consulted for a second opinion," Dr. Mehmet Oz, is little out there himself.

He's touted on Oprah's site.

And they offered no proof whatsoever that anything "John of God" has ever done has ever actually helped anyone.
